I just picked up a used idle cintroller box and I am not sure where to plug it into. Any idea where the plug goes and about how much is this thing worth because i dont have much in it? thanks in advance.
If it is a Genuine Ford idle controller, the plug for it is almost under the ash tray. Mine was under there. Get a flashlight and look, it shouldn't be that deep in, but it is in the ashtray area. Used on ebay I see they go for around 100-150. Big bucks brand new though from Ford.

Wow, can't beat that!!!! Just plug and play. Don't look too hard as it might be right in front of you (like I did) it isn't plugged into anything. If anything it would be from the ashtray to the passenger side like a 1' area. One thing: for standard or auto you have to engage the parking brake at least enough to turn the brake light on in the dash then you can engage it.
